diff --git a/src/video_core/renderer_vulkan/renderer_vulkan.cpp b/src/video_core/renderer_vulkan/renderer_vulkan.cpp index b0782ee0f4..bceb7bc09a 100644 --- a/src/video_core/renderer_vulkan/renderer_vulkan.cpp +++ b/src/video_core/renderer_vulkan/renderer_vulkan.cpp @@ -273,9 +273,6 @@ void RendererVulkan::Composite(std::span framebu swapchain.GetImageViewFormat()); scheduler.Flush(*interpolated_frame->render_ready); present_manager.Present(interpolated_frame); - - // Optionally, update previous_frame here if you want to chain interpolations - previous_frame = interpolated_frame; return; } @@ -297,11 +294,6 @@ void RendererVulkan::Composite(std::span framebu scheduler.Flush(*frame->render_ready); present_manager.Present(frame); - if (frame_interpolation_enabled) { - // Store the current frame for interpolation on the next call - previous_frame = frame; - } - gpu.RendererFrameEndNotify(); rasterizer.TickFrame(); }